Rwanda government report assigns responsibility to France for enabling 1994 Rwandan Genocide
The French government bears significant responsibility for enabling the 1994 Rwandan Genocide, according to a Monday report from the Rwandan government. The report was commissioned by the Rwandan government in 2017 and compiled by Robert Muse of the Washington, DC, law firm of Levy Firestone Muse. Rwandan woman deported from US arrested for role in genocide
A woman who served a 10-year sentence in US prison for lying about her role in the 1994 Rwandan genocide to obtain American citizenship was deported to Rwanda on Friday. French commission on Rwanda genocide finds France bears responsibility but was not complicit
The Research Commission on the French Archives relating to Rwanda and the Tutsi genocide (Duclert Commission) on Friday submitted its report to French President Emmanuel Macron finding that the country bears responsibility due to its inaction, but was not complicit with the regime that perpetrated the genocide. Rwanda court rules it has jurisdiction to try 'Hotel Rwanda' hero Paul Rusesabagina
Rwanda’s High Court Chamber for International and Cross-border Crimes on Friday ruled that it has jurisdiction to try Paul Rusesabagina, whose actions inspired the film “Hotel Rwanda,” on the charges of terrorism financing, armed robbery, abduction, arson, attempted murder, assault, and battery. Paul Rusesabagina of 'Hotel Rwanda' fame goes on trial in Kigali
The trial of Paul Rusesabagina, whose actions inspired the film “Hotel Rwanda,” began Wednesday in Kigali, the capital of Rwanda. During the 1994 Rwandan genocide, Rusesabagina saved hundreds of lives by providing shelter to people at the hotel where he worked as a manager. IRMCT orders transfer of alleged Rwanda genocide financier to The Hague due to health concerns
Lord Iain Bonomy, a judge for the International Residual Mechanism for Criminal Tribunals that is handling the remaining business of the former international criminal courts for Yugoslavia and Rwanda, approved the transfer of Félicien Kabuga to The Hague Wednesday.
